- Make SQL Transactions actual objects used in code. (Thanks to Derex for the idea) * Uncommitted transactions will be automatically rolled back and cleaned up using ACE_Refcounted_Auto_Ptr, so no need to call Rollback() in the code. * Prevents recursive transactions and makes developers aware of transactions going on. * Gets rid of unneccesary overhead iterating over a concurrent map. - Some cleanups in affected code, including better usage of transaction control in AH / mail related code to prevent data loss. *** Experimental, use at own risk, recommended to backup your DBs. *** --HG-- branch : trunk
